Steelix is one of the best walls around. Rhyperior has a 2.66 weakness to Water and Grass, two pretty common attack types. You really don't need another tank. Steelix does good.

Steelix plays the role of a defense wall and you don't have another defense wall with Rhyperior. And Steelix has a 200 Base Defense (0.0)

Well, for the Elite Four, the most important aspect is versatility, so you'll need to cover a large amount of types with only a few Pokemon.

Charizard (Obviously, since you requested him, and he's a good choice at that. He should be able to breeze through the first battle, and take care of Lucian's Bronzong.)
Torterra (A solid Grass type, and can breeze through your second battle. Earthquake comes in handy as well.)
Luxray (A very powerful Electric Pokemon, able to make short work of numerous enemies. Be sure to give him Crunch to take care of Ghosts or Psychics.)

That covers most of the important bases. The rest are mainly filler. They can come in handy, but you may want to mix a few Pokemon around.

Swampert (Meh, any water type will do, but Swampert can learn Earthquake, which is useful no matter who uses it. Whatever you choose, make sure it knows Ice Beam.)
Alakazam (A good Psychic user can be very helpful in tight spots. Make sure Alakazam doesn't get hit too hard, though.)
Heracross (A good fighter can also be pretty helpful. All you really need is Close Combat, but Megahorn can take out a few Psychics if you're lucky)

That's my recommended team. Feel free to change things around, however.
